Brief Summary

To evaluate the effectiveness of ultrasound guided Erector Spinae Plane Block (ESPB) in controlling post thoracotomy ipsilateral shoulder pain.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A) physical status class I and II.
  • Age ≥ 18 and ≤ 60 Years.
  • Patients undergoing thoracic surgery e.g.: metastatectomy, lobectomy, pneumonectomy or pleuro-pneumonectomy.

Exclusion

  • Patient refusal.
  • Local infection at the puncture site.
  • Coagulopathy with the international normalized ratio (INR) ≥ 1.6: hereditary (e.g. hemophilia, fibrinogen abnormalities and deficiency of factor II) - acquired (e.g. impaired liver functions with prothrombin concentration less than 60 %, vitamin K deficiency \& therapeutic anticoagulants drugs).
  • Unstable cardiovascular disease.
  • History of psychiatric and cognitive disorders.
  • Patients allergic to medication used.
